“Moorea is the most beautiful island in the world,” says travel writer Bill Goodwin in Frommer's South Pacific. “Nothing compares with its sawtooth ridges and the dark-green hulk of Mount Rotui separating Cook's and Opunohu bays.” Just 9 miles northwest of Tahiti in the South Pacific, the tiny French Polynesian island of Moorea is less congested than its better-known neighbor. But it’s a hidden gem for its gorgeous mountain vistas, and while you’re here, you can swim with dolphins. Meanwhile, Tahiti is just as picturesque; it’s known as the gateway to French Polynesia, dating back to the late 18th century when Captain Cook first sailed ashore.
